The Ember Flyer is a one-person, physical airplane with modified open source flight script. It is presented Copy/Mod/No Trans. It was inspired by the earliest airplanes, such as the Wright Flyer.
Instructions:
To board, right click the aircraft and choose "Fly!" from the pie menu.
Chat commands:
start: Starts engine and engages controls
stop: Stops engine
Keyboard controls:
Pg Up: Increase throttle in 10% increments
Pg Dn: Decrease throttle in 10% increments
Fwd arrow: pitch down/foward
Back arrow: pitch up/back
Left arrow: turn left
Right arrow: turn right
Full lift occurs when throttle reaches 50%. Minimum throttle from powered flight is 10%, but after turning engines off (by saying "stop" in local chat), a single tap on the Pg Dn key should put throttle to 0%.
